State about the Complex partial seizures
Complex partial seizures, another type of focal seizure, originate most commonly in the temporal lobe. Complex partial seizures are characterised by three common manifestations:
1) Subjective experiences that presage the attack such as forced, repetitive thoughts, sudden alterations in mood, feelings of deja vu, or hallucinations;
2) Automatisms, which are repetitive stereotyped movements such as lip smacking or chewing or activities such as undoing buttons; and
3) Postural changes, such as when the person assumes a catatonic, or frozen, posture.
